A senior varsity official announced on Tuesday that Delhi University will create two distinct portals for admissions to undergraduate and postgraduate degrees using the Common Seat Allocation System. By 20 May 2023, the university would most likely start the admissions process.

Undergraduate and graduate admissions will be handled by CSAS (UG) 2023 and CSAS (PG) 2023, respectively. The institution will be using the Common Institution Entrance Test for the first time in order to admit students to post-graduate studies.

'For admissions to graduate and postgraduate programs, we will be developing two distinct portals', the source said. 'Last year, we used the CUET to administer admissions for the first time. The admissions (process) will be easier this year. We are also prepared to undertake the first-ever PG admittance. We are also sure of that, the official continued. Undergraduate and graduate applications for CUET programmes are now being accepted'.
